Overlapping WiFi coverage areas

Hi,

When faced with the task of blanketing a large area (>> that which can be covered by a single AP), are there some basic guidelines to follow? Beyond the stipulation to arrange AP's in triads such that no two adjacent share a channel (1,6,11), how worthwhile is it to tune Tx power, etc.? What are the likely *dynamic* elements that will cause performance to change, over time (e.g., walking water-bags, etc.)? What are good *quantitative* criteria that can be used in establishing the initial topology?
